ORDER

This writ petition has been filed for issuance of writ of mandamus, directing the third respondent to repay the sum of Rs. 14,30,251/- in the light of the proceedings dated 27.12.2017 within a time frame fixed by this Court.

2. Heard Mr.B.Brijesh Kishore, learned counsel for the petitioner and Mr.B.Saravanan, learned Additional Government Pleader for the first respondent.

3. When the matter was taken up for hearing, the lear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that out of the total amount of Rs.14,30,251/-, the petitioner has been paid a sum of Rs.5,80,000/- by way of installments during the pendency of this writ petition and the balance amount is yet to be paid.

4. It is also clear from the proceedings dated 27.12.2017 that the amount is due and payable to the father of the petitioner, and on his demise, the 2/4

petitioner is entitled to receive the same. In view of the above, there shall be a direction to the third respondent to pay the balance amount of Rs.8,50,251/- (Rupees Eight Lakhs and Fifty Thousand and Two Fifty One only) with interest at 6% per annum from 2016 till the date of payment of the remaining amount to the petitioner. This payment shall be made to the petitioner within a period of three months from the date of receipt of a copy of this order.
